I'm not sure if I was compiling this code, I'll double check. The 'z' should be valid, but I doubt it's important and you can probably comment out the #define in pyconfig.h. Or you could temporarily build without python to see if 4.4 works for you in general. BTW I'm using Python 2.6.1 here. Jon Massimiliano Maini wrote: > > Latest code (20090625), with gcc44: > > In file included from dbprovider.c:25: > config.h:97:1: warning: this is the location of the previous definition > dbprovider.c: In function 'ConvertPythonToRowset': > dbprovider.c:429: warning: unknown conversion type character 'z' in format > dbprovider.c:429: warning: too many arguments for format > dbprovider.c:442: warning: unknown conversion type character 'z' in format > dbprovider.c:442: warning: unknown conversion type character 'z' in format > dbprovider.c:442: warning: too many arguments for format > dbprovider.c:466: warning: unknown conversion type character 'z' in format > dbprovider.c:466: warning: too many arguments for format > > Plus this: > > In file included from gnubg.c:89: > d:\documents\max\gnubg-build\tools\mingwgcc44\bin\../lib/gcc/mingw32/4.4.0/../../../../include/ws2tcpip.h:272: > error: two or more data types in declaration specifiers > > Caused by Pyconfig.h: > > /* Define to `int' if doesn't define. */ > #if _MSC_VER + 0>= 1300 > /* VC.NET typedefs socklen_t in ws2tcpip.h. */ > #else > #define socklen_t int > #endif > > Found that: http://bugs.python.org/issue3257 > > Should we move to python 2.6 or 3 ? > > MaX.
